Summary/Objective

The Proposal Specialist reports to the Director of Marketing, Proposals and is responsible for managing the organization and creation of proposals and RFP responses from start to finish. Guidepost is seeking a talented writer and storyteller to create compelling responses that highlight Guidepost’s strengths and differentiators, tailoring content to meet client expectations. We expect that the content developed will be authentic, interesting, and easy to digest while adhering to corporate strategy, standards, brand positioning, and tone of voice.  You will lead multiple stakeholders through a detailed, multi-step process, to produce proposals that drive recognition, support Guidepost’s expanding brand, and win work. Beyond proposals, some assistance with additional marketing communications from web content, brochures, etc. is to be expected.

 

Essential Functions

Candidates must have the ability to:

  • Analyze an RFP to determine requirements and understand how to tailor content to produce a dynamic response that positions Guidepost to win.
  • Professionally manage a detailed, multi-step, multi-stakeholder process that requires consistent follow-up, clear/concise communication, and persistence to guide the proposal from kick-off to completion, including managing senior project managers and directors.
  • Using a proposal creation software, design customized proposals that are concise, compliant, logical, and incorporate content provided by key stakeholders.
  • Leverage existing proposal material for rapid response to opportunities, as needed; conduct additional research as required to develop a compliant, compelling response.
  • Review, edit, and proofread proposals and other materials to ensure accuracy, clarity, consistency and compliance with firm guidelines and standards.
  • Support multiple projects simultaneously, prioritize assignments and complete tasks within firm deadlines and in a team environment.
  • Thrive in a fast-paced, deadline driven environment.
  • Print, assemble and ship (when required) on deadline.
  • Capture essential data for the proposal content library.
  • Work collaboratively with the greater marketing team.
